Cardiology and Neurology - Launceston General Hospital

The Cardiology and Neurology department is divided into two areas:

Cardiology

Provides non-invasive services to both inpatients and outpatients from the North of Tasmania.

Non-invasive procedures include:

  • Transthoracic and transoesophageal echocardiograms;
  • Holter monitors;
  • Event monitors;
  • Stress testing;
  • Tilt table testing; and
  • Pacemaker follow-up clinics.

Invasive procedures include:

  • Diagnostic angiography;
  • Angioplasty; and
  • Pacemaker implants.

Cardiologists also provide outpatients consultation clinics in the Specialist Clinic located on Level 3 of the LGH every week.

Neurology

The Neurology section provides:

  • Diagnostic electroephalography;
  • Nerve conduction studies; and
  • Electromyography and Botulinus Toxin injection therapy.

A Neurologist also provides a consultation service in the Specialist Clinic located on Level 3 of the LGH once a week.

All tests are covered by Medicare and are Bulk Billed.
